Broken seals
Misting and condensation are caused by a break in the seal between the panes of your double-glazed windows. This allows moisture in the insulation section of the window, which causes the efficiency of the window to decrease, and warm air to enter the home. Luckily, there are some easy steps you can take to repair these problems.
The first step is to determine whether the condensation or misting is located on the outside or inside of the window. If the condensation is located outside it is a natural phenomenon that is caused by changes in weather conditions. It is not a problem with your double-glazed. If the condensation is located on the inside, it's a sign that the seal has failed and needs to be replaced.
If your windows are covered by warranty the installers will repair the issue at no cost to you. Alternatively, you can hire an experienced window replacement company to replace your windows at a reasonable price. This is a great way of purchasing new, energy-efficient windows without having to replace your frames and walls.
Keep the frame in good condition to avoid a double-glazing seal breaking. Every two years, the exterior seams must be caulked and the wood should be given an all-new coat. You should also avoid using high-pressure washers on your windows as they can harm the glass insulated unit.

Energy efficiency
Double glazing is a worthy investment for any house, bringing more warmth and reducing outside noise however, it could be even more efficient when it comes to energy efficiency. The layer of gas between the two panes serves as insulation and keeps the cold air out, while keeping warm air inside. This helps reduce your heating costs.
If your double glazing begins to form condensation between the panes of glass, it will not perform the task and you may see an increase in your energy bills. Luckily, misted windows can be repaired and, in certain instances it's all that's needed.
Most often, windows that are misty are caused by a failed seal between two panes. This allows moisture enter. This is typically caused by old windows that have become damaged over time, but it could be caused by a poorly installed window or a new one that has been damaged through accident.
The window will no longer be a sealed unit and it won't be able to keep the cold air out and your warm air in, meaning that you're losing money and energy.
